According to geoscientists, the Earth’s shape is most accurately described as an oblate ellipsoid (or oblate spheroid), meaning it is flattened at the poles and bulges at the equator due to its rotation. While it is also approximately spherical or close to that of a sphere, “oblate ellipsoid” is the precise geodetic term for its overall shape. “Close to that of a sphere” is also accurate as it acknowledges the deviation from a perfect sphere while still capturing the general shape. “Round” and “spherical” are less precise terms used in common language.
Geoscientists use precise terms like ‘oblate ellipsoid’ to describe the Earth’s shape, which deviates from a perfect sphere.
The Earth’s equatorial diameter is about 43 km larger than its polar diameter. This slight bulge makes ‘oblate ellipsoid’ the most accurate geometric model. Saying it’s “close to that of a sphere” is also factually correct, as the deviation is relatively small compared to the overall size.
